  Baked stuffed papayas
 
Yield: 4 Servings
 
1 ea Medium Onion; chopped      1 ea Clove garlic; finely chopped
1 lb Ground Beef      1 ea 16oz. can whole tomato;drain
1 ea Jalapeno; finely chopped      1/2 ts Salt
1/4 ts Pepper      4 ea Papayas (about 12oz. each)
2 tb Parmesan cheese;grated
 Cook and stir beef onion and garlic in 10-inch skillet over medium heat until beef is light brown. Drain; stir in tomatoes jalapeno pepper salt and pepper. Break up tomatoes with fork. Heat to boiling. Reduce heat; simmer uncovered until most of the liquid is evaporated about 10 minutes. Cut papayas lengthwise into halves and remove seeds. Place aobut 1/3 cup beef mixture in each papaya half. Sprinkle with cheese. Arrange in shallow roasting pan. Pour very hot water into pan to within 1 inch of tops of papaya halves. Bake uncovered at 350 degrees until papayas are very tender and hot about 30 minutes. ** Recipe from Betty Crocker Regional and International Recipes.
